Auto switch cache policy and Auto shutdown |
| |
When a RAID controller detects conditions exceeding preset thresholds, the following actions will be exerted to protect the hardware:
- Automatically flush cached data and switch the array's caching mode from write-back to write-through
- Commence an auto shutdown
What is remarkable is all environmental thresholds associated with this mechanism are user-configurable and that caching mode changes back to write-back once normal condition is restored. |
